By Kim Bo-eun
Competition among streaming platforms here is set to intensify this year as HBO is expected to launch its own over-the-top (OTT) media service in the local market.
HBO Max is the OTT service of U.S. entertainment giant WarnerMedia, which owns shows such as "Game of Thrones" and the "Harry Potter" series.
HBO Max's launch appears imminent, given that it is not renewing contracts with other OTTs offering HBO shows here. Local OTT service, Watcha, has stopped offering HBO's hit series, "Game of Thrones," along with other shows of the U.S. TV broadcaster, as of Dec. 31. Netflix also stopped offering shows such as "Big Bang Theory," "Friends," and the "Dark Knight" series, which HBO Max has offered in other markets.
Disney Plus, which debuted in Korea in November, stopped other OTTs offering its content prior to its launch.
WarnerMedia is currently hiring over 30s positions at HBO Max Korea.
In September, actress Lee Si-young shared on Instagram a photo of herself on the set of "Mentalist," shot in collaboration with HBO Max, stating that the show had completed filming. WarnerMedia holds the intellectual property rights to the original program and Lee took part in the production of a local version with actor Park Si-hoo.
The entry of global entertainment platforms into the local market is leading to expectations in the industry for more locally-produced shows that could become global hits, such as Nexflix's "Squid Game."
Apple TV+ and Disney Plus launched their services here last year and the arrival of HBO Plus also means global OTTs are expected to compete fiercely to attract more viewers. Streaming platforms have become a key source of entertainment amid the COVID-19 pandemic.
Half of all people who viewed OTT services were paid users in 2021, according to data from the Korea Communications Commission. This figure is up from 7.7 percent in 2018, 14.9 percent in 2019 and 21.7 percent in 2020.
Netflix was the dominant OTT platform here with 9.1 million viewers as of July 2021. Local platforms Wavve and Tving followed with 3.2 million and 2.8 million viewers each.
HBO Max has seen its subscribers grow. The platform had 69.4 million subscribers globally as of the third quarter of 2021, up from 15.9 million in the same quarter of 2020. HBO Max is currently available in select countries in North and South America, the Caribbean and Europe. The platform offers two monthly subscription plans: one with ads for $9.99 and an ad-free version for $14.99.
